after some more shearching and calling a few places I found that Energy Suspension does make some:

Part no.
16.3112 (front control arm set) 5gh gen prelude SH
16.3119 (rear control arm set) 4th and 5th gen preludes.

Is the SH upper control arm the same as the base? Now that's the new question
